    Vor 3 Tagen · Niels Henrik David Bohr ( Danish: [ˈne̝ls ˈpoɐ̯ˀ]; 7 October 1885 – 18 November 1962) was a Danish physicist who made foundational contributions to understanding atomic structure and quantum theory, for which he received the Nobel Prize in Physics in 1922. Bohr was also a philosopher and a promoter of scientific research.

  2. In 1913, physicists Niels Bohr and Ernest Rutherford proposed the RutherfordBohr model, which is now commonly referred to simply as the Bohr model. The model describes electrons as small negatively charged particles orbiting a dense, positively charged nucleus.
